Output 70e1e7ba2408386371a33c84aa821d22ef963986f4a6772a765f3fd19a8149ec:0

value
21340
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8861350ed454f0228649d90fdc2ff52fb83f5519e4dc5b4360c3bb88500cdcfd
address
tb1p3psn2rk52ncz9pjfmy8actl497ur74geunw9ksmqcwacs5qvmn7smtnyhl
transaction
70e1e7ba2408386371a33c84aa821d22ef963986f4a6772a765f3fd19a8149ec
confirmations
82497
spent
true